M.D.C. Holdings' Southern California Division Wins Builder of the Year Award
PR Newswire
DENVER

DENVER, March 14, 2013 /PRNewswire/ -- M.D.C. Holdings, Inc. (NYSE: MDC) today announced that the Southern California division of its subsidiary, Richmond American Homes of Maryland, Inc., was recently named 2012 Builder of the Year by the Building Industry Association of Southern California's Riverside Chapter. The homebuilder beat out 160 area builders to take top honors. The award recognizes leadership within the industry, dedication to community service and commitment to building quality homes.

With more than three decades of homebuilding experience, the Richmond American Homes companies operate in 11 states. They have been actively building in California for almost 20 years and they currently have 13 communities throughout the region stretching from Los Angeles County to many cities in the Inland Empire.

Richmond American is dedicated to working with municipalities to advocate on behalf of the industry. Leonard Miller, Richmond American's Regional President, was recently elected president of the Builders Industry Association of Southern California and sits on the board of directors.

"We're honored to receive this award," Mr. Miller said. "We take pride in the homes we build and our leadership role in the industry. Giving back to the community is a company tradition; it's great to see those efforts recognized."

About MDC

Since 1972, MDC's subsidiary companies have built and financed the American dream for more than 170,000 homebuyers. MDC's commitment to customer satisfaction, quality and value is reflected in each home its subsidiaries build. MDC is one of the largest homebuilders in the United States. Its subsidiaries have homebuilding operations across the country, including the metropolitan areas of Denver, Colorado Springs, Salt Lake City, Las Vegas, Phoenix, Tucson, Riverside-San Bernardino, Los Angeles, San Francisco Bay Area, Washington D.C., Baltimore, Philadelphia, Jacksonville and Seattle. The Company's subsidiaries also provide mortgage financing, insurance and title services, primarily for Richmond American homebuyers, through HomeAmerican Mortgage Corporation, American Home Insurance Agency, Inc. and American Home Title and Escrow Company, respectively. M.D.C. Holdings, Inc. is traded on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ol "MDC." For more information, visit www.mdcholdings.com
